Subject: [PATCH 2/9] KVM: Separate update irq to a single function

Separate INTx enabling part to a independence function, so that we can add MSI
enabling part easily.

+static int assigned_device_update_intx(struct kvm *kvm,
+ struct kvm_assigned_dev_kernel *adev,
+ struct kvm_assigned_irq *airq)
+{
+ if (adev->irq_requested) {
+ adev->guest_irq = airq->guest_irq;
+ adev->ack_notifier.gsi = airq->guest_irq;
+ return 0;
+ }
+
+ if (irqchip_in_kernel(kvm)) {
+ if (!capable(CAP_SYS_RAWIO))
+ return -EPERM;
+
+ if (airq->host_irq)
+ adev->host_irq = airq->host_irq;
+ else
+ adev->host_irq = adev->dev->irq;
+ adev->guest_irq = airq->guest_irq;
+ adev->ack_notifier.gsi = airq->guest_irq;
+
+ /* Even though this is PCI, we don't want to use shared
+ * interrupts. Sharing host devices with guest-assigned devices
+ * on the same interrupt line is not a happy situation: there
+ * are going to be long delays in accepting, acking, etc.
+ */
+ if (request_irq(adev->host_irq, kvm_assigned_dev_intr,
+ 0, "kvm_assigned_intx_device", (void *)adev))
+ return -EIO;
+ }
+
+ adev->irq_requested = true;
+ return 0;
+}
